*,*:before,*:after{box-sizing:border-box}:root{--bg: #ffffff;--fg: #000000;--border: rgba(0,0,0,.25);--bg-transparent: rgba(255,255,255,.125);--bg-transparent-2: rgba(255,255,255,.4);--logo: rgba(0,0,0,.25)}html.dark{--bg: #000000;--fg: #ffffff;--border: rgba(255,255,255,.2);--bg-transparent: rgba(0,0,0,.0125);--bg-transparent-2: rgba(0,0,0,.2);--logo: rgba(255,255,255,.25)}html,body{background:var(--bg);color:var(--fg);transition:background .3s ease,color .3s ease;padding:0;margin:0}.theme{background:transparent;color:var(--fg);border:none;padding:0;cursor:pointer;font-size:20px}.palette-card{border:1px solid var(--border);padding:8px}@media (prefers-color-scheme: dark){html:not(.light):not(.dark){--bg: #000000;--fg: #ffffff;--border: rgba(255,255,255,.125);--bg-transparent: rgba(0,0,0,.0125);--bg-transparent-2: rgba(0,0,0,.2)}}.skeleton{display:flex;align-items:center;justify-content:center;background:linear-gradient(45deg,#e0e0e0 25%,#f5f5f5,#e0e0e0 75%);background-size:400% 400%;animation:shimmer 1.2s ease infinite}@keyframes shimmer{0%{background-position:0 0}to{background-position:200% 0}}.spin:after{content:"";width:16px;height:16px;border:2px solid var(--fg);border-top-color:transparent;border-radius:50%;display:inline-block;animation:rot .8s linear infinite}@keyframes rot{to{transform:rotate(360deg)}}.palette-card.selected{box-shadow:inset 0 0 0 .5px var(--bg-transparent),0 0 32px 1px var(--bg-transparent-2)}.mesh-bg{position:fixed;inset:0;z-index:-1;pointer-events:none;filter:blur(80px) saturate(200%);transition:background .8s ease}@keyframes slowMove{0%{transform:translate(0) scale(1)}to{transform:translate(-10%,-10%) scale(1.15)}}@keyframes fadeIn{0%{opacity:0}to{opacity:1}}.grid-1-2{grid-template-columns:1fr 2fr}.grid-1{grid-teamplate-columns:repeate(1,1fr)}.upload-height{aspect-ratio:1.5/1;width:100%}@media (min-width: 44em){.grid-1-2-l{grid-template-columns:1fr 2fr}}.hide-child .child{transition:opacity .5s ease;opacity:1}.hide-child:hover .child{opacity:0;transition:none}
